garlic chicken & potato skillet

Ingredients
- 4 medium chicken breasts, boneless and skinless
- 2 large baking potatoes
- 5 tablespoons butter, cold
- 1/2 teaspoon garlic, minced
- 1 can cream of chicken soup
- 1/2 cup whipping cream or milk
- 1/4 cup parmesan cheese
- 1 bunch asparagus, fresh or any vegetable you choose
- - salt and pepper to taste
How To Make garlic chicken & potato skillet
-
Step 1Preheat oven to 375
-
Step 2Put potatoes in microwave for 4 minutes to help get them cooking. Dice potatoes once cool enough to handle.
-
Step 3Over medium heat in a cast iron skillet place potatoes, butter, and garlic. Let potatoes get just a little crispy on both sides flipping them with spatula. 5-10 minutes.
-
Step 4Once potatoes have crisp up place the chicken breasts on top of potatoes, cover and cook for 10 minutes. Add asparagus or vegetable of your choice, cover, and cook an additional 5 minutes.
-
Step 5Meanwhile, mix soup, milk, salt, and pepper together and pour on top of chicken and vegetables. Sprinkle Parmesan cheese on top.
-
Step 6Move skillet to oven and let bake until chicken is completely cooked.
